The difference between CCD sheet semi-enclosed labeling equipment and CCD vision double-sided labeling machine

There are significant differences in function and application between CCD sheet labeling machines and CCD vision folio labelers.

CCD sheet labeling machines are automated machines specifically designed for labeling sheet products. They operate in a semi-enclosed environment, effectively preventing interference from dust and other contaminants, ensuring accurate and stable labeling. These machines can typically accommodate sheet products of varying sizes and shapes, offering high efficiency, accuracy, and ease of operation, significantly improving labeling efficiency and quality.

CCD vision-based split-sheet labeling machines, on the other hand, primarily rely on CCD vision positioning technology to precisely locate and label products. They use a camera to capture images of the product surface and, using image processing techniques, extract product features such as edges and corners, enabling precise positioning. Based on this, the labeling machine accurately applies labels or tape to the designated location on the product. This type of equipment typically features high precision, high speed, and high reliability, adapting to a variety of complex labeling needs.

In general, CCD sheet semi-enclosed labeling machines focus on efficient and stable labeling of sheet products in specific environments, while CCD vision-based split-sheet labeling machines prioritize precise positioning and labeling through vision positioning technology. While each focuses on different functions and applications, both are automated mechanical equipment designed to improve labeling efficiency and quality.
